Time-Traveling Twins: The Quest for the Missing Crystal
Once upon a time, in a quaint little town nestled between rolling hills and whispering woods, there lived two identical twin brothers, Alex and Jamie. They were not just alike in appearance but also in spirit, each with a curious mind and a heart full of adventure. Their parents, Dr. Evelyn and Professor Arthur, were renowned historians, and their home was filled with ancient artifacts and maps that told stories of distant lands and forgotten times.
One evening, as they were poring over an old, dusty book in their attic, they stumbled upon a peculiar crystal. The crystal was unlike any they had ever seen, glowing with a soft, ethereal light. It had a small, intricate symbol etched on its surface, which seemed to pulse with a mysterious energy.
"Look, Jamie," Alex whispered, his eyes wide with wonder. "This must be the key to something incredible."
Jamie nodded, his curiosity piqued. "What do you think it does?"
Dr. Evelyn, who had been watching them from the doorway, stepped forward. "I believe this crystal is a time-traveling device. It's said that it can transport its user to any time and place in the universe."
Before they could react, a sudden jolt of energy from the crystal sent them spinning around. When they opened their eyes, they found themselves standing in a bustling marketplace, surrounded by people in strange, ancient clothes.
"Where are we?" Jamie asked, his voice tinged with awe.
"Welcome to the World of the Time Travelers," a voice echoed in their minds. "You have been chosen to embark on a quest to find the missing crystal. It has been lost for centuries, and only you, with your unique bond as twins, can restore it to its rightful place."
The brothers were faced with a moral dilemma: should they go on this quest, knowing that it could change the course of history, or should they return home, safe in the knowledge that they could never know what lay ahead?
After much deliberation, they decided to accept the challenge. They had always been close, and the prospect of exploring the vast expanse of time together was too tantalizing to resist.
Their first stop was ancient Egypt, where they were greeted by a wise old pharaoh who had been waiting for them. The pharaoh explained that the crystal had once been a part of his treasure, but it had been stolen by a cunning thief who had used it to travel through time.
"The thief has left a trail of clues, but he is a clever man," the pharaoh said. "You must follow the trail carefully, or you may never find him."
The brothers set off on their quest, following the clues through the bustling streets of ancient Rome, the grand halls of medieval castles, and the bustling markets of Renaissance Florence. Each time they followed a clue, they learned more about the history of the crystal and the thief who had stolen it.
One day, as they were exploring a forgotten library in medieval Japan, they stumbled upon a hidden room filled with ancient scrolls and artifacts. Among them was a scroll that detailed the final clue to the thief's whereabouts: a hidden chamber in the heart of an active volcano.
With renewed determination, the brothers set off for the volcano. As they climbed the treacherous slopes, they were attacked by bandits who had heard rumors of the hidden treasure. In a fierce battle, they managed to defeat the bandits and continue their journey.
When they finally reached the heart of the volcano, they found themselves in a magnificent chamber, illuminated by the soft glow of the crystal. In the center of the chamber stood the thief, a man with a twisted smile and eyes full of malice.
"Finally, you have come," the thief said. "I have been waiting for you, for centuries."
Alex stepped forward, his voice steady. "Why did you steal the crystal?"
The thief's eyes darkened. "For power. I wanted to control time, to be the master of the universe."
Jamie interjected, "But why? What good would that do you?"
The thief laughed, a sound that echoed like thunder in the chamber. "Because it would make me immortal."
Before the brothers could react, the thief reached for the crystal. Alex and Jamie leaped forward, grasping the thief's hands and pulling him away from the crystal. In a struggle that seemed to go on forever, the brothers managed to pin the thief down and take the crystal back.
With the crystal in their possession, they knew they had to return it to the pharaoh in Egypt. As they traveled back through time, they couldn't help but reflect on their journey. They had faced moral dilemmas, overcome obstacles, and forged an unbreakable bond along the way.
When they finally returned to their own time, they handed the crystal to Dr. Evelyn and Professor Arthur, who were waiting for them in the attic. The parents smiled warmly, knowing that their sons had grown and learned much on their adventure.
"Thank you for bringing it back," Dr. Evelyn said. "It is a precious artifact, and it will be preserved for future generations."
The brothers nodded, feeling a sense of pride and accomplishment. They had not only found the missing crystal but had also discovered the true power of family and friendship.
From that day on, the twin brothers continued to explore the world, not just through time, but through life, always ready for the next adventure that awaited them.
